Is it necessary to pull another flood cert when we pulled one last month and already know property is in a flood zone? Property is already collateral on one loan and has sufficient insurance. Officer is making a letter of credit where same property is cross collateralizing this letter of credit.

You have to provide a new notice. How that notice is generated really depends on your document systems and vendors.

Most banks get a recertification of the original FHD rather than themselves pulling the flood maps and making sure that the maps have not changed and then documenting all of this. The vendor would then provide a new notice.
